J2EE中利用JSON+jQuery_AJAX实现动态加载与异步表单提交
5星 · 超过95%的资源 需积分: 9 63 浏览量
更新于2024-09-20
收藏 264KB PDF 举报
本文主要探讨了在J2EE框架下的JSON与jQuery_AJAX技术在实现页面动态加载和异步表单提交的应用。作者基于Spring+Struts+Ibatis的开发环境,详细介绍了如何利用JSON处理数据以及与jQuery相结合进行AJAX操作。
首先,文章强调了依赖的库文件,包括JSON相关的jar包如json-lib.jar,以及jQuery库文件,这些是实现AJAX交互的基础。在J2EE web项目中,这些版本可能根据需求进行调整。
JSON的使用在于其数据格式化,便于JavaScript进行处理。它可以将JavaBean对象转换为JSONObject,使得前端能够轻松地解析和操作。例如,一个简单的JavaBean可以转化为易于读取的JSON对象,Map则转换为JSONObject,而List则转为JSONArray。为了将JSON数据传递到页面,示例代码展示了如何通过jQuery的$.getJSON方法获取数据,同时指出对于大数据量的情况,可能需要采用POST请求,并确保dataType设置为"json"以充分利用JSON的特性。
页面动态加载是通过jQuery的AJAX方法实现的,如$.ajax或$.getJSON,它们允许页面在不重新加载整个页面的情况下更新部分内容。具体到表单内容的异步提交,文章提到了一个名为jquery_ajaxSubmit的辅助函数,它结合jQuery的form.js插件,简化了表单数据的异步提交过程。
接下来,文章对JSON+jQuery_AJAX的实现进行了深入分析,讨论了其在实际项目中的优势和应用场景,比如在河南移动绩效管理项目一期中可能的应用场景。
总结部分可能会回顾整个技术流程,强调其在提高用户体验、优化服务器性能等方面的价值,并可能提到一些最佳实践和注意事项。最后,文章可能包含一个实用性的附录,列出进一步的学习资源或代码示例,以便读者更深入地理解和应用JSON+jQuery_AJAX技术。
这篇文档为开发者提供了一个清晰的指南,展示了如何在J2EE环境中有效地利用JSON和jQuery_AJAX技术进行页面动态加载和表单异步提交,有助于提升开发效率和用户体验。
2019-07-22 上传
2021-10-11 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
yexinhan
- 粉丝: 0
- 资源: 5
最新资源
- 俄罗斯RTSD数据集实现交通标志实时检测
- 易语言开发的文件批量改名工具使用Ex_Dui美化界面
- 爱心援助动态网页教程:前端开发实战指南
- 复旦微电子数字电路课件4章同步时序电路详解
- Dylan Manley的编程投资组合登录页面设计介绍
- Python实现H3K4me3与H3K27ac表观遗传标记域长度分析
- 易语言开源播放器项目:简易界面与强大的音频支持
- 介绍rxtx2.2全系统环境下的Java版本使用
- ZStack-CC2530 半开源协议栈使用与安装指南
- 易语言实现的八斗平台与淘宝评论采集软件开发
- Christiano响应式网站项目设计与技术特点
- QT图形框架中QGraphicRectItem的插入与缩放技术
- 组合逻辑电路深入解析与习题教程
- Vue+ECharts实现中国地图3D展示与交互功能
- MiSTer_MAME_SCRIPTS:自动下载MAME与HBMAME脚本指南
- 前端技术精髓:构建响应式盆栽展示网站